Meaning of Take her ass to court
To initiate legal action against someone in court.
In simple words: To bring a legal case against someone.
Take her ass to court in a sentence
- If she doesn't pay the bill, I will take her ass to court.
- Don't think you can just ignore this; I will take her ass to court if necessary.
How to use Take her ass to court
This phrase is often used in casual conversation and can imply taking a strong action against someone. It may not be suitable for formal discussions.

Synonyms for Take her ass to court
- sue her
- file a lawsuit against her
- take legal action against her
Common mistakes with Take her ass to court
- Confused with 'take her to court' without the slang.
- Using it too formally in professional contexts.
- Not understanding the slang meaning of 'ass' as it relates to a person.
